2003 3 Watt - 28 Volts, Class C Microwave 2000 MHz GENERAL DESCRIPTION The 2003 is a COMMON BASE transistor capable of providing 3 Watts Class C, RF output power at 2000 MHz. Gold metalization and diffused ballasting are used to provide high reliability and supreme ruggedness. The transistor is uses a fully hermetic High Temperature solder Sealed package.
